1. Recognize the Software Engineer’s Role

Starting your trip, it is critical you know what software engineers do. Using programming languages and development frameworks, they create, implement, try, and support software programs. Software engineers are employed in various industries including media, technology, healthcare, and finance.

Typical tasks include:

  • Writing clear, efficient code.
  • Debug software problems and address them
  • Working together with stakeholders and designers
  • Testing software for performance and security and fine-tuning it
  • Keep current with industry developments and acquire new technologies.
  • Abstractly designing system architecture
  • guaranteeing dependability and software scalability

5. Expert in Algorithms and Data Structures

Writing effective code depends much on knowledge of algorithms and data structures. Technical interviews are where several businesses try out these ideas. Primary issues are:

  • Arrays plus linked lists
  • Stacks and Lineups
  • hash tables and graphs
  • search and sort algorithms
  • Dynamic Programming and Recursion
  • Complexity analysis using Big O notation
  • Dijkstra’s algorithm, Floyd-Warshall, and others.

9. Get ready for technical interviews.

Landing a job entails passing technical interviews evaluating your system design, problem-solving, and coding abilities. Follow these steps:

  • Do coding exercises on HackerRank and LeetCode.
  • Explore regular technical and behavioral interview questions-
  • Study system design ideas (scalability, database architecture, among others).
  • Invite friends to fake interviews or utilize websites like Pramp and Interviewing.io
  • Improve your knowledge of problem-solving approaches including greedy algorithms and dynamic programming.
